So, when I got the opportunity to review a Juppy Baby Walker I jumped on it.  The Juppy I was sent was black and Juppy personalized it just for FB.  I have to admit, it was much nicer than I had expected.  The harness is strong and I had no doubt it would support FB comfortably.  She gave every indication that she was enjoying being in it also.


 
I am only 5 foot tall, no more, no less, so I don't have to bend that much when Remi is holding my fingers to walk.  My husband on the other hand is over 6 feet, and he also has a very bad back.  This is a life saver for him.  The best part about it, the straps are adjustable.  I can support FB in the Juppy Baby Walker just as comfortably as my husband. 


 
FB took off when we put her in her Juppy, which by the way came with a beautiful carrying case. The Juppy fits right into your purse or diaper bag.  I actually tied the case around the strap of my diaper bag.  I don't know about you but my diaper bag is packed full.



The Juppy Baby Walker that I received is amazing, but they have also come up with the new Momentum.  It's the Juppy Walker improved.  The Momentum has super comfortable holding straps and 2 Velcro straps to overlap the back zipper in the back for added safety and security.
